`
流浪鱼
  • 浏览: 1648692 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

type命令

 
阅读更多

一般情况下,type命令被用于判断另外一个命令是否是内置命令,但是它实际上有更多的用法。 

type命令用来显示指定命令的类型。一个命令的类型可以是如下之一

alias 别名

keyword 关键字,Shell保留字

function 函数,Shell函数

builtin 内建命令,Shell内建命令

file 文件,磁盘文件,外部命令

unfound 没有找到

它是Linux系统的一种自省机制,知道了是哪种类型,我们就可以针对性的获取帮助。比如:

内建命令可以用help命令来获取帮助,外部命令用man或者info来获取帮助。

 

常用参数

type命令的基本使用方式就是直接跟上命令名字。

type -a可以显示所有可能的类型,比如有些命令如pwd是shell内建命令,也可以是外部命令。

type -p只返回外部命令的信息,相当于which命令。

type -f只返回shell函数的信息。

type -t 只返回指定类型的信息。

分享到:
评论

相关推荐

    consoletype命令 输出已连接的终端类型

    consoletype命令用于打印已连接的终端类型到标准输出,并能够检查已连接的终端是当前终端还是虚拟终端。 语法格式:consoletype 参考实例 输出已连接的终端类型: [root@linuxcool ~]# consoletype 与该功能相关的...

    type命令 显示指定命令的类型

    type命令用来显示指定命令的类型,判断给出的指令是内部指令还是外部指令。 语法格式:type [参数] [命令] 常用参数: lias 别名 keyword 关键字,Shell保留字 function 函数,Shell函数 builtin 内建命令...

    把文件以ASCII码字符方式输出

    用基本文件操作编写DOS下的type命令,即把文件内容以ASCII码字符方式向标准输出设备输出。

    Unix 命令全集

    type 命令 ucfgif 方法 ucfginet 方法 ucfgqos 方法 ucfgvsd 命令 uconvdef 命令 udefif 方法 udefinet 方法 udfcheck 命令 udfcreate 命令 udflabel 命令 uil 命令 uimx 命令 ul 命令 ulimit 命令 umask 命令 ...

    linux文件系统及文件操作命令

    在 Linux 中,可以使用 type 命令来查看命令是否是内置命令或外部命令。例如,使用 type ls 命令可以查看 ls 命令是否是内置命令: ``` $ type ls ``` 如果 ls 命令是内置命令,输出结果将是「ls is a shell ...

    最全批处理命令学习资料

    批处理命令学习资料 批处理文件是扩展名为.bat或.cmd的...5. type命令:用于显示文件内容。 批处理命令是系统管理员和开发者日常工作中的重要工具,它们可以帮助我们快速地完成一些重复性的任务,从而提高工作效率。

    第四课:创建目录之MD命令的详解.exe

    第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息 第16课:测试网络连接命令 第17课...

    DOS命令说明.docx

    type *.txt 命令将显示当前目录里所有.txt 文件的内容。 copy 命令 copy 命令用于拷贝文件。copy c:\test.txt d:\test.bak 命令将复制 c:\test.txt 文件到 d:\test.bak。copy con test.txt 命令将从屏幕上等待输入...

    第五课:文件管理之删除目录(RD)命令的详解.docx

    第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息 第16课:测试网络连接命令 第17课...

    Dos命令大全

    7. TYPE命令:显示文件内容命令,格式为TYPE [盘符:][路径] 〈文件名〉。例如,C:\>type yyy.txt。 8. EDIT命令:编辑文件内容命令,格式为EDIT [盘符:][路径] 〈文件名〉。例如,C:\>edit yyy.txt。 9. REN命令...

    DOS命令的使用

    常用DOS命令的使用: 1.DIR命令: 作用:显示磁盘文件。 格式:DIR 被显示的文件盘符、路径、文件名 ...5.TYPE命令: 作用:显示以ASCII形式保存到磁盘上的文件的内容 格式:TYPE 被显示内容的文件名字

    批处理命令大全

    type命令用于显示文件内容。例如: * type c:\boot.ini:显示指定文件的内容,程序文件一般会显示乱码 * type *.txt:显示当前目录里所有.txt文件的内容 11. copy命令 copy命令用于拷贝文件。例如: * copy c:\...

    第四课:创建目录之MD命令的详解.docx

    第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息 第16课:测试网络连接命令 第17课...

    Linux 命令入门文档.zip

    - 学习 Bash 的基础知识。具体地,在命令行中输入 `man ...你可以用 `type 命令` 来判断这个命令到底是可执行文件、shell 内置命令还是别名。 - 学会使用 `>` 和 `来重定向输出和输入,学会使用 `|` 来重定向管道。

    windows下which命令(附带源码和实现说明)

    windows系统下没有unix/linux的which或者type命令,在cmd或者脚本中,执行的命令其实际路径很难定位,网上找了很多资源,不甚理想,于是自己写了一个。 工具使用格式为which target,其原理是遍历PATHEXT环境变量下...

    FTP服务器 C#

    // 处理不需登录即可响应的命令(这里只处理QUIT) if (command == "QUIT") { // 关闭TCP连接并释放与其关联的所有资源 user.commandSession.Close(); return; } else { switch (user.loginOK) { // ...

    FTP客户端源码

    跨平台的C++FTP客户端源码 class ftpclient { public: ftpclient(const char* connmode="port", const char* transmode="binary"); ~ftpclient(void); int connect(const char* addr, short port);...

    DOS前15课.zip

    适合人群:计算机初学者,学习DOS...第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息

    第二课:DOS命令行的详解.docx

    第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息 第16课:测试网络连接命令 第17课...

    第一课:进入DOS的世界.exe

    第11课:文件管理之type命令的使用 第12课:文件管理之文件属性的设置-attrib命令 第13课:ipconfig 命令详解 第14课:设置启动选项与服务--MSConfig命令 第15课:查看计算端口信息 第16课:测试网络连接命令 第17课...

Global site tag (gtag.js) - Google Analytics